@Robertriley 's Chris's frame and fork above fills an empty space with few if any other examples. It gives us very valuable information regarding these serial numbers. His "C29914" serial numbered Shelby Cycle Co frame & fork clearly suggests it is a 1928 moto bike. Don't see this often.

Thank you for your post of this late 1938 "R" serial number Shelby. There are also a few "T", or 39's so far seen here. Not many of the straight-bars with original tanks well cared for like yours. Killer seat.
 
I believe that that 26” balloon tire frame style is post-war, like 1946–G, or there abouts.

Interesting that the stamper, or someone else (QA or an owner?) saw the half-G stamp on the left, so apparently added another full-G stamp (1/4”?) on the right.

Looks like Shelby was still using some kind of dip-brazing fabrication methods.
